Java 보안: 잘못된 키 크기 예외 해결
Java에서 강력한 키 크기의 암호화 알고리즘을 사용하려면 추가 권한이나 정책이 필요할 수 있습니다. 파일. "잘못된 키 크기 또는 기본 매개변수" 예외는 일반적으로 기본 또는 허용된 제한을 초과하는 키 크기를 활용하려고 할 때 발생합니다.
귀하의 경우 Java 1.6.0.26으로 업그레이드한 후 다음과 같은 경우에 이 문제가 발생했습니다. 이전에 Java 1.6.0.12에서 완벽하게 실행되었던 코드를 실행 중입니다. 이는 Java 설치 구성에 뭔가가 변경되었음을 의미합니다.
해결책:
가장 가능성 있는 설명은 JCE(Java Cryptography Extension) Unlimited Strength Jurisdiction이 없다는 것입니다. 정책 파일. 이러한 파일은 Java에서 강력한 암호화 알고리즘을 활성화하는 데 필요합니다.
이 문제를 해결하려면 Java 버전에 대한 무제한 강도 정책 파일을 가져와야 합니다.
다운로드한 후 ZIP에서 JAR 파일을 추출하세요. 아카이브하여 다음 디렉토리에 저장하세요.
${java.home}/jre/lib/security/
다시 시작하세요. Java 애플리케이션 및 "잘못된 키 크기 또는 기본 매개변수" 예외가 해결되어야 합니다.
위 내용은 JVM 업데이트 후 Java에서 '잘못된 키 크기 또는 기본 매개변수' 예외를 수정하는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!